Self-Aligning Dry-Running Flanged Sleeve Bearings
![](/prerenderstable/mvPRE/contents/gfx/imagecache/516/5168n11black-medium-gloss-plasticpositive_right_positive_top_standard15_1608050161_553@halfx_637436253898429429.png?ver=imagenotfound)
![](/prerenderstable/mvPRE/contents/gfx/imagecache/516/5168n11l1-length--master1608056621-p9@halfx_637436318351385256.png?ver=imagenotfound)
Compensating for minor shaft misalignment and not requiring lubrication, these sleeve bearings swivel to self-align and are dry running. They don’t need a housing and you can install and replace them without any tools because they’re slip fit. Mount them in injection-molded panels, thin sheet metal, and hard non-ductile material. Made of acetal, they won’t warp or swell when exposed to water, so they’re good for washdown environments.
